AB56-SA3,154,23 23(1p) Student loan refinancing study committee.
AB56-SA3,155,4
1(a) There is created the student loan refinancing study committee to study the
2creation and administration of a bonding authority for the refinancing of student
3loans in this state in order to ease the burden of student loan debt for this state's
4residents.
AB56-SA3,155,6 5(b) The student loan refinancing study committee shall consist of the following
6members:
AB56-SA3,155,7 71. The secretary of financial institutions.
AB56-SA3,155,8 82. The state treasurer.
AB56-SA3,155,9 93. The executive secretary of the higher educational aids board.
AB56-SA3,155,13 10(c) No later than October 1, 2020, the student loan refinancing study committee
11shall submit to the governor and to the chief clerk of each house of the legislature,
12for distribution to the appropriate standing committees under s. 13.172 (3), a report
13that includes all of the following:
AB56-SA3,155,15 141. Recommendations regarding the corporate and legal structure of the
15refinancing entity, including governance.
AB56-SA3,155,19 162. A profile of the loan portfolio, projected start-up and operational costs,
17estimated staffing needs, underwriting requirements, and other information
18pertinent to the creation of a refinancing entity that can offer interest rate savings
19to this state's student loan debtors.
AB56-SA3,155,22 203. An assessment of the feasibility of and options for offering protections to
21borrowers refinancing student debt through the refinancing entity that are similar
22to the protections under federal student loan programs.
AB56-SA3,155,25 23(d) The department of financial institutions shall pay the administrative
24expenses of the student loan refinancing study committee, not exceeding a total of
25$50,000, from the appropriation account under s. 20.144 (1) (g).
AB56-SA3,156,2
1(e) The student loan refinancing study committee terminates upon the
2submission of the report under par. (c).”.
